Last Close (May 9): 96.90 points, up 0.03 of a point from a week ago. Week’s high: 96.90 points; Week’s low: 96.87 points.
The Malaysia Derivatives Exchange (MDEX) interest-rate futures prices trend higher in very thin trading and closed Friday with moderate gains. Expectations that the soon-to-be-announced economic stimulus package would result in a dip in interest rates encouraged some light short-covering last week.
